WHY WE LIKE IT

It is a Crémant (Sparkling Wine) from Anjou, similar to Champagne.

The denomination "Champagne" in  France can only be used for wines deriving from vines and wines made in the French region of Champagne (North-East of France with the unofficial capital Reims).

All the other French sparkling wines, vinified in regions other than Champagne take the denomination of “Crémant.

 

Crement de Loire

Like Champagne, this Crémant is also aged on lattes (strips).

Aging on strips is a technique that only concerns sparkling wines produced in the French regions of Champagne or in the Loire Valley.

After alcoholic fermentation, the wine is bottled with a small dose of sugar to restart fermentation and produce carbonic gas.

The bottles are stored horizontally on wooden strips for at least one year, so that the "foam setting" process takes place correctly.

This is a very regulated process. The minimum period of refinement on the strips is mandatory for each type of champagne: 12 months minimum; 15 months for non-vintage champagne; 3 years for vintage champagnes.

Some houses don't hesitate to keep their best champagnes for 10, even 15 years.

The Anjou and in particular the Côteaux du Layon

A French region renowned for its white and especially rosé wines.

The particular formation of the soil, unique of its kind, composed of ftanite (sedimentary stone), schist, limestone, gravel and sand, allow the vinification of excellent wines, characterized by fruity notes and unique softness, much appreciated in France and throughout the world. .

The CELLAR by Pierre Chauvin

Domain Pierre CHAUVIN

The first lands of the Domaine Pierre Chauvin à Côteaux du Layon, in the heart of Anjou (France), were purchased in 1859. Since then 5 generations have succeeded.

Today the Domaine extends over 15 hectares.

 

 

Natural and Organic Wine

In the constant concern for respect for the environment, in 2000 the Domaine adhered to the "Terra Vitis" Charter, a French brand that guarantees respect for sustainable environmental agriculture.

In 2005 the whole Domaine was converted toorganic farming (Certified by Bureau Veritas). The first AB certified harvest took place three years later in 2008.

The wine is produced in the most natural way possible, in order to find in the wine all the fruit potential of the grape.

Cèpage present on the Domaine: Chenin (white), Cabernet Franc (red and rosé), Grolleau and Cabernet Sauvignon.
